State Republican leaders are accusing a community-based group it claims has links to Democratic presidential nominee Barack Obama, of deliberately filing fraudulent voter registration forms across the state.
Voter registration officials in Harrisburg, Philadelphia and Allegheny County have reported problems with registrations filed on behalf of voters by The Association of Community Organizations, or ACORN. ...
A York man employed by ACORN part-time was arrested Saturday and charged with submitting more than 100 bogus registrations during an eight-day period in June. ...
